Saudi air defenses down Houthi drone over Khamees Musheit

RIYADH-SABA
The air defenses of the Saudi-led Arab Coalition downed a Houthi armed drone over the sky of Khamees Musheit in Saudi Arabia early Thursday.
The Yemeni militia launched the drone from the northern Yemen province of Sana'a to attack civil properties in the Saudi city.
The Coalition's spokesman Col. Turki al-Maliki denied the militia's claim the drone attacked sensitive sites in King Khaled airbase saying the Houthi "lies refllet the state of despair the militia is going through."
But he said the repeated Houthi attempts to attack civilians and civilian places proves the criminality and terrorism of this militia whose hostilities have moved to the level of war crimes according to the international humanitarian law.
